SVPWM Simulation Model Using MATLAB Simulink. This model implements Space Vector Pulse Width Modulation (SVPWM) technology for precise AC motor control. Built on the MATLAB Simulink platform, it provides a reliable and efficient framework for simulating and analyzing motor performance characteristics. The implementation includes adjustable SVPWM algorithm parameters and flexible motor control strategies to optimize operational efficiency. Key components feature sector identification logic, voltage vector calculation modules, and PWM signal generation blocks that demonstrate proper switching sequence implementation. This model serves as an excellent educational tool for understanding AC motor operational principles and provides valuable references for designing and optimizing motor control systems through practical simulation exercises.
